How to fill out music licensing guide

How to fill out music licensing guide
01
Step 1: Start by collecting all necessary information about your music, including the title, composer, publisher, and any copyright owners.
02
Step 2: Determine the type of music licensing you require. This can include synchronization licenses for use in films, TV shows, or commercials, mechanical licenses for the reproduction and distribution of your music, or performance licenses for live performances or radio broadcasts.
03
Step 3: Research the appropriate licensing organizations or agencies that handle the type of licensing you need. For example, ASCAP, BMI, and SESAC in the United States can help with performance licenses, while Harry Fox Agency can assist with mechanical licenses.
04
Step 4: Fill out the music licensing application form provided by the respective licensing organization. Make sure to provide accurate and complete information about your music and intended use.
05
Step 5: Pay any necessary fees associated with the licensing process. These fees can vary depending on the type of license and the licensing organization.
06
Step 6: Submit your completed application form and supporting documents to the licensing organization. Ensure everything is properly filled out and signed.
07
Step 7: Await the review and approval of your application. This process may take some time, so be patient.
08
Step 8: Once approved, make sure to keep a copy of your licensing agreement for future reference or if any disputes arise.
09
Step 9: Ensure that you adhere to the terms and conditions specified in your licensing agreement, including any reporting or royalty payment obligations.
10
Step 10: If your music is used in a public performance, make sure the appropriate venue or broadcaster tracks and reports the usage to the licensing organization, so you receive proper royalties.
Who needs music licensing guide?
01
Musicians, composers, and songwriters who create original music and want to protect their intellectual property rights.
02
Music producers and record labels who want to legally use copyrighted music in their projects.
03
Film, TV, and commercial producers who want to incorporate music into their productions.
04
Radio stations and broadcasters who need licenses for the music they play on the airwaves.
05
Live performers and concert organizers who require licenses for public performances.
06
Businesses and establishments that play music for customers, such as restaurants, bars, and shops.
